Hm... First off, I would recommend that you upgrade your Red Hat 5.1
installation to Red Hat 6.0 :). Red Hat 6.0 has a substancially better
user interface collection (there is KDE for the hard core Windows users,
and GNOME for those who like the ability to customize the UI, and make
things look really cool :). I've run them both on a 486, and they both
operate at about the speed of Windows (which is pretty slow) on the 486,
but on faster machines, they really do take off. I run GNOME on my P133,
and it's good ;).
After you get the new interfaces installed, you can start doing things
witht the interface -- system configuration, package installation, etc.,
and email, AIM, ICQ, and many other things :).
For AIM, GAIM is a great tool. For ICQ, I haven't tried anything, but
I've heard that licq is good, and I'm going to try gnomeicu, which is
supposedly based on licq. :) Anyway, you'll have a blast :).
